ABSTRACTThis study aims to find out the profile of teachers' constructivist practice and it effects on self-efficacy and student cognitive learning outcomes. The subjects of the study are two Biology teachers and a group of first year high school students in Kayen district, Pati. The instrument of data collection is consists of questionnaire, observation sheet, and score document. The data of the research are analyzed with quantitative approach. The results show that both teachers get average score of 3,16 and 3,63. Those scores are classified as high criterion. Based on the N-gain test, the result of students’ cognitive learning has medium to high criteria. The students' cognitive and self-efficacy learning outcomes in all classes before and after constructivist practice on learning by teachers significantly differ (p <0.05). Although the result of student's self-efficacy in N-gain test shows low to moderate criteria, the result of the analysis shows that there is positive correlation in students’ self-efficacy caused by constructivist practice by teachers with cognitive learning outcomes. It can be concluded that a profile of teachers' constructivist practice is classified as high category which has positive effect on self-efficacy and student learning outcomes. Keyword: cognitive learning achievment, constructivist, self-efficacy ABSTRAKPenelitian ini bertujuan untuk mengetahui profil praksis konstruktivis guru serta pengaruhnya terhadap self efficacy dan hasil belajar kognitif siswa. This research was motivated by the learning outcomes of SMAN 5 Tapung students who were under the target (KKM). This research was to intend providing the solutions by applying Bandicam videos in the learning. The purpose of this study was to improve student learning outcomes on trigonometric comparison material in right triangles using Bandicam video media in class X Mia SMAN 5 Tapung. This study used a quantitative approach with interview observation steps, survey methods and blended learning methods. The research subjects were students of class X MIA SMAN 5 Tapung and the object of this study was the use of videos recorded with the Bandicam application to improve cognitive mathematics learning outcomes. Data collection techniques used tests, observations, and documentation, while data analysis techniques used qualitative descriptive data analysis methods. The average score obtained by students at the end of the first cycle was 67.6 with the number of students who reached the KKM as many as 32 students (43.7%), then at the end of the second cycle the average value of students increased to 77.4 and as many as 32 students scored reaching the KKM (87.5%). By increasing the KKM results obtained after learning using Bandicam video media, the cognitive learning outcomes of students are increased.

The 21st-century biology learning requires technology-based learning which is potential in improving students’ learning outcomes. This research aimed to examine the validity and effectiveness of web-based learning media on Archaebacteria and Eubacteria on learning process. This web-based learning media was structured by using 4-D Thiagarajan model. The research was conducted at three SSHSs of Samarinda. The data were obtained from validators’ (media expert, material expert, and linguist), teachers’, and students’ opinion by using questionnaire; while the effectiveness was determined based on students’ test score and their response. The results showed that the web-based learning media was very valid with the average score from experts as high as 95.27%. Moreover, this media has been proven to improve the student’s cognitive learning outcomes (gain score 0.39) and well responded by both teachers and students.

The aims of this study are to determine the differences in students’  learning interest, to know the differences in the level of students’ learning independence,  to know the  differences in achievements of cognitive learning outcomes of students who learn conventionally and those who  learn  using  blended learning method. The type of this research is quasi experiment with pretest-posttest controlled group design. Control class learn conventionally while experimental classes learn in blended learning, which is a conventional learning process combined with online learning, by utilizing the application of Quipper school. Students’ learning interest in control class before the learning process gets an average value of 118.74 while after the learning process gets an average value of 123.78. As for the experimental class, before the learning process gets an average value of 119.89 while after the learning process gets an average score of 131.21. For the level of students’ learning independence of the control class during the learning process gets an average score of 28.5 while for the experimental class during the learning process gets an average score of 35.1. So there is a difference of 6.6 between the control class and the experimental class. The students’ cognitive learning outcomes of the control class before the learning process gets an average score of 40.3, while after the learning process gets an average score of 58.67. As for the experimental class, before the learning process gets an average score of 42.29 while after the learning process gets an average score of 76.71. So the increase of control class is 18,37 while experiment class is 34,43.

Local wisdom-based science learning modules are one of the science learning models that are oriented to the integration of the values of community local wisdom into science learning material. The aim of the study was to develop a science learning module based on the local wisdom of Sembalun Village to improve the cognitive learning outcomes of junior high school students. The research is a development research with a 4-D model design consisting of 4 stages: define, design, develop, and disseminate. Research instruments included local wisdom observation sheets, expert validation sheets, learning comprehension observation sheets, cognitive learning outcomes tests, and student response questionnaire sheets. Data collection techniques used is local wisdom observation techniques, validation, observation, tests, and questionnaires. The results of the study stated that the interview results obtained a total score of 62% with good categories. The modules that have been developed are then validated by 2 expert lecturers, with an average score of 3.70 with valid / non-revised categories. Implementation of learning (RPP) with an overall average score of 89.9% with a very good category. Cognitive learning outcomes of students in the small scale readability test with the N-Gain value of 0.36 with the medium category. Response of students with an overall average score of 3.47 in the good category. The results of the study can be concluded that the local wisdom based science learning module can improve the cognitive learning outcomes of VII class Mts Al-Banun students.

 This research aimed to determine the effectiveness of the implementation of concept attainment learning model to increase cognitive learning outcomes. The research method used is pre-experimental design with intact group comparison design. The research subjects were students of class XI SMA Negeri 9 Pekanbaru, in which class XI IPA4 was an experimental class and class XI IPA5 was a control class. The experimental class uses a concept attainment learning model and a control class with a conventional learning. The data was obtained from cognitive learning outcomes test which given to students after the learning process was carried out. Data were analyzed descriptively to provide an overview of students cognitive learning outcomes including students absorption and learning effectiveness on indication of global warming material. The research result obtained were the average of students absorption ability in the experimental class was 76,94% and 68,33% for control class. Thus, can be concluded that the implementation of the concept attainment learning model was effective to increase student cognitive learning outcomes in SMA Negeri 9 Pekanbaru on the subject of global warming.

A research has been conducted to develop a physic learning media in form of android-based pocket book. We designed Harmonic Oscillation pocket book and test its feasibility and effectiveness in improving cognitive learning outcomes of students. This study using research and development method adapted from ADDIE model. The results revealed that this software has been successfully developed and is very feasible to be used as a physics learning media. This Android-based Harmonic Oscillation pocket book is effective in enhancing students cognitive learning outcomes and students showed positive tendency response toward the software.
